It’s the week of love at The Children’s House!! We will be focusing on emotions this week, and talking about what love means to us all – who we love, who loves us, and most importantly, what we love about our own selves! It’s sometimes hard for young children to recognise and verbalise their emotions, so we use a lot of strategies in the classroom to help them with this – for instance visual aids like emotion wheels, and naming feelings for children when they are upset e.g. ‘I can see you seem upset that it’s not your turn to give out the plates today’, and then giving them tools for improving the situation themselves e.g. ‘what do you think might make you feel better? Is there anything I can do to help?’ This helps children to develop their emotional literacy and well-being, and supports them to learn skills of resilience for later in life.

Five Little Hearts (fingerplay)

Five little hearts all in a row ,
The first one said ‘I love you so’,
The second one said ‘will you be my Valentine?’
The third one said ‘I will, if you’ll be mine’
The fourth one said ‘I’ll always be your friend’
The fifth one said ‘we’ll all be friends until the end!’
